Output 2ffed590d9eda593239130be5d9f5ea27f56c82d9011ea14ced9419ecddfa125:3

value
1523727
script pubkey
OP_0 OP_PUSHBYTES_20 10453c375ac53b3ba042bcbdc1631abdc4a94af2
address
bc1qzpzncd66c5anhgzzhj7uzcc6hhz2jjhjljyj52
transaction
2ffed590d9eda593239130be5d9f5ea27f56c82d9011ea14ced9419ecddfa125
confirmations
58613
spent
true